todd nichols Welcome, I think you are going to enjoy carving birds. Most wood carving supply catalogs have bird patterns you can buy individually. Most have cut out blanks you can buy if you don’t have a saw. To get a good head start I would recommend a book or a video that takes you through the whole process, they are also available the wood carving supply stores.
Thanks for your question. When doing detailing on a small carving, I use an Excel handle and a #11 hobby craft blade. I do strop them before I use them so I can change them out quickly when they get dull.
